TS LAWCET 2026 Syllabus covers key subjects such as General Knowledge, Mental Ability, and Aptitude for the Study of Law, helping candidates understand the topics they need to prepare for the exam. The Telangana State Council of Higher Education (TSCHE) has released the TS LAWCET Syllabus 2026 online with the official notification. The syllabus was released along with the official notification on the official website at lawcet.tsche.ac.in.The TS LAWCET Syllabus 2026 includes three main sections, namely, GK and Mental Ability, Current Affairs, and Aptitude for the Study of Law.
The syllabus of TS LAWCET 2026 is the same for both the 3-Year LLB and 5-Year LLB programmes. The 5-year LLB exam is based on the Intermediate (10+2) level, while the 3-year LLB exam is of graduate level. The weightage of topics is the same for both the 3-Year and 5-Year LLB Programmes. TS LAWCET 2026 Syllabus
The TS LAWCET 2026 Syllabus is divided into three sections. These include General Knowledge & Mental Ability, Current Affairs, and Aptitude for the Study of Law. Some important topics of General Knowledge & Mental Ability include History, Geography, Blood Relation, Syllogism, Logical Reasoning, etc. Current Affairs’ important topics include National and International Events, Awards, Politics, Economy, etc. Important TS LAWCET 2026 Exam topics of Aptitude for the Study of Law consist of the Indian Constitution, Legal Awareness, Contract Law, Legal Reasoning and Principles, etc. Check out the table below for the TS LAWCET Syllabus 2026:

TS LAWCET 2026 Syllabus: Section-Wise Weightage
The TS LAWCET 2026 Exam has different levels of difficulty for 3-year and 5-year LLB courses. The 5-year LLB course of TS LAWCET is based on intermediate (Class 10+2) level questions, while the 3-year LLB paper is set at the graduate level. Aptitude for Law has the highest weightage among all three sections. Check out the table below for TS LAWCET 2026 Section-Wise Weightage.

TS LAWCET 2026 Exam Pattern
TS LAWCET 2026 will be conducted online in a computer-based test mode. The TS LAWCET Question Paper will consist of objective-type questions only. The total number of questions is 120, and the total duration of the exam is 90 minutes. Each correct answer carries one mark, and there is no negative marking. The exam will only be taken in English, Urdu, and Telugu. Check out the table below for the TS LAWCET 2026 Exam Pattern.

TS LAWCET 2026 Syllabus FAQs
What is the total number of questions in TS LAWCET 2026?
TS LAWCET 2026 will have 120 objective-type questions.
Is there any negative marking in TS LAWCET 2026?
No, there is no negative marking in TS LAWCET 2026, so candidates can attempt all questions.
What is the difficulty level of TS LAWCET 2026?
TS LAWCET 2026 is of intermediate level for the 5-year LLB and degree level for the 3-year LLB. The questions are simple but require conceptual understanding.
Which subjects are included in the TS LAWCET 2026 syllabus?
The TS LAWCET 2026 syllabus includes General Knowledge, Current Affairs, and Aptitude for Law.
What topics are asked in the Aptitude for Law section in TS LAWCET 2026?
The Aptitude for Law section includes legal reasoning, legal maxims, the Constitution of India, IPC, contract laws, and case analysis questions.

How many marks are allotted to each section in TS LAWCET 2026?
TS LAWCET 2026 allots 60 marks to Law Aptitude and 30 marks each to General Knowledge and Current Affairs, making a total of 120 marks.
Are mental ability questions important in TS LAWCET 2026?
Yes, Mental Ability questions are part of the General Knowledge section and test logical and analytical thinking.
